Which carbohydrate makes up the cell wall of fungi?A: ChitinB: CelluloseC: Glycogen

<span>A. Chitin

Chitin is a nitrogen containing polysaccharide. Fungi build their chitin from a disaccharide of acetyglucoamine a modified sugar they polymerize into chitin.

Cellulose and glycogen are polysaccharides. Cellulose is linear while glycogen is a branched polysaccharide. </span>

Would vision and audition be considered "higher senses” in non-human animals? Why or why not?
Dimas [21]

Answer:

Not necessarily

Explanation:

There are animals in which vision and audition are more specialized than in humans, while in other species this relation fails. For example, in predatory birds, the vision clarity surpassing human eyesight, since this sense is required for effective prey capture. Conversely, in the European mole (<em>Talpa europaea</em>), which is a mammal that lives mostly underground, the vision is seriously short-sighted. These are clear examples that "the function makes the organ", ie., phenotypic features such as vision and audition are selected in the course of evolution depending on the fitness that they confer to the species in particular environmental conditions.

Aquatic organisms are able to survive when the temperature decreases. These organisms survive even when the surfaces of lakes an
umka2103 [35]

Answer:

Anomalous expansion

Explanation:

Anomalous expansion of water is the abnormal way water expands when exposed to low temperature.

At 4 degree Celsius , the density at the top layer is usually at the Maximum which makes the water sinks down and then the water in the lower layer rises up.

When the temperature drops below 4 degree Celsius, the water molecules at the top then freezes leaving the denser molecules at the bottom which doesn’t freeze as a result of their high density.

This way, organisms can survive in the water due to the lower layer not freezing.

What aspect of chromosome behavior most clearly accounts for Mendel's law of segregation?
svetlana [45]

The given question is incomplete as the group of choices lack the correct answer, however, the correct group of choices are as follows:

A. Movement of sister chromatids to opposite poles at anaphase II of meiosis.

B. Movement of homologous chromosomes to opposite poles at anaphase I of meiosis.

C. Crossing over between homologous chromosomes during prophase I of meiosis.

D.  Replication of chromosomes prior to meiosis.

E. Independent alignment of different homologous pairs on the metaphase I spindle.

Answer:

The correct answer is :  Movement of homologous chromosomes to opposite poles at anaphase I of meiosis.

Explanation:

The Mendel's law of segregation says that during formation of gametes the copies of genes segregate from each other so each gamete has equal and only one allele of the gene.

This behavior of homologous chromosome can be seen in anaphase I in meiosis, responsible for the segregation of copies of allele into different copies.

Thus, the correct answer is :  Movement of homologous chromosomes to opposite poles at anaphase I of meiosis.
